About #7CCBBF Color Code
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 171°, a saturation of 43%, and a lightness of 64%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 171°, a saturation of 39%, and a value of 80%.
- HEX: #7CCBBF
- RGB: rgb(124, 203, 191)
- HSL: hsl(171, 43%, 64%)
- HSV: hsv(171, 39%, 80%)
- CMYK: 39.00% cyan, 0.00% magenta, 6.00% yellow, 20.00% black
- XYZ: 39.24, 50.45, 43.29
- Yxy: 50.45, 0.2951, 0.3794
- Hunter Lab: 76.35, -27.52, -2.08
- CIE-Lab: 76.35, -27.52, -2.08
In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 39.24, Y: 50.45, Z: 43.29.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 50.45, x: 0.2951, and y: 0.3794.
In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 76.35, a: -27.52, and b: -2.08.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 76.35, a: -27.52, and b: -2.08.
